34 Birdbrook Road

    34, BIRDBROOK ROAD, BIRMINGHAM, B44 8RB

    This terraced freehold property on Birdbrook Road last sold in October 2018 for £107,500. Based on price growth in the B44 district since then, its estimated current value is £157,260 — placing it in the 14th percentile nationally and the 11th percentile within B44. The property covers 81 m² (872 sq ft), giving an estimated value of £1,941 per m². The EPC rating is E, with a potential rating of C.
